Nokia Oyj (NYSE:NOK) shares are up on Friday morning, while the broader market shows mixed performance.

• Nokia stock is gaining positive traction. What’s driving NOK shares up?

In the recent past, Nokia announced a partnership, which is expected to close in the fourth quarter of 2026, with Lockheed Martin Corporation (NYSE:LMT) to enhance secure communications for U.S. and allied defense forces. The collaboration aims to deliver modular 5G capabilities for military vehicles and involves joint initiatives in 6G, AI and wireless edge technologies.

Nokia recently reported net sales of $5.26 billion, up 4% year over year, but missed consensus estimates of $5.40 billion. Additionally, the company’s EPS came in at six cents, below expectations but representing a 67% year-on-year increase.

Nokia is a networking equipment vendor focused primarily on supporting wireless networks and, to a growing extent, Internet Protocol and optical systems. The firm operates three segments: mobile infrastructure, network infrastructure and portfolio business. The mobile infrastructure segment sells equipment and software used to operate the core of carrier and enterprise wireless networks, while the network infrastructure segment includes IP, optical, and fixed-network equipment.
